Caffeine Kick: How Much Is in a Can of Red Bull?

Red Bull is a popular energy drink known for its powerful caffeine kick. But just how much energizing goodness does a single can really contain? On average, a standard 8.4 fluid ounce can of Red Bull packs around 75 milligrams of caffeine. That's about equivalent to a cup of coffee, which can provide some boost to your energy levels.
